Tailor made holidays: Mexico offers 'fascinating' activities

Families planning tailor made holidays in Mexico will find lots of fascinating things to do and see in the country, it has been claimed.

Mexican opera star Rolando Villazon claimed that there are many tourist attractions in the "great country" including the beautiful Oaxaxa city.
He wrote in the Daily Mail: "The region also boasts Monte Alban, spectacular ruins dating back to 500 BC, which are 1,300 ft up the mountain.

"The ancient Zapotec people actually levelled the mountain top so they could build this ceremonial site. The views are fantastic."

The country is also home to a number of romantic and secluded locations, such as the town of San Miguel de Allende, which is now a Unesco World Heritage Site.

Newlyweds could consider following in Mr Villazon's footsteps and taking their honeymoon in the town, which is filled with cobbled streets, elegant squares, colonial homes and stunning churches and chapels.
